Where Are Winn Golf Grips Manufactured?
Winn Golf Grips are renowned in the golfing community for their innovative design and comfort. If you’re curious about where these grips are made, the answer is that Winn Grips are primarily manufactured in Taiwan. This location is known for its advanced manufacturing techniques and high-quality production standards.

The Benefits of Winn Grips
Winn Golf Grips offer several advantages that enhance your golfing experience:
- Comfort: The polymer material provides a soft feel, reducing hand fatigue during long rounds.
- Shock Absorption: These grips effectively absorb vibrations, which can improve your control and precision.
- Variety: Winn offers a wide range of grips tailored for different types of clubs, including putters, drivers, and irons.
- Weather Resistance: The grips maintain their performance in various weather conditions, ensuring a consistent feel.

Practical Tips for Choosing and Maintaining Winn Grips
When selecting and maintaining your Winn Grips, consider the following tips:
- Choose the Right Size: Ensure that you select grips that fit your hand size for maximum comfort and control.
- Regular Cleaning: Keep your grips clean to maintain their performance. Use a damp cloth and mild soap to wipe them down.
- Inspect for Wear: Regularly check your grips for signs of wear and tear. Replacing worn grips can improve your game significantly.
- Temperature Awareness: Store your clubs in a moderate temperature environment to prevent damage to the grips.

How often should I replace my golf grips?
It’s generally recommended to replace your golf grips every 40 rounds or once a year, whichever comes first, depending on usage.
